Overview
AMES Maximum Stretch Roof Coating is a crisp white, elastomeric sealant designed for low-slope roofs. The coating feels rubbery yet flexible, moving with the roof as temperatures rise and fall. Its impressive 650% elongation helps resist cracking and peeling on aging substrates, while the bright white finish reflects sunlight and can contribute to cooler roof surfaces. While outcomes vary by project and climate, this coating aims to provide a durable, weather-ready layer that protects the roof and preserves its appearance.
What makes it stand out
The formulation blends acrylic elasticity with rubberized durability. It adheres to a variety of substrates, offering versatility for maintenance across metal roofing, tar, and rolled roofs. The coating can be brushed, rolled, or sprayed, enabling flexibility for different roof shapes and project sizes. Non-toxic and low-VOC, it emphasizes safer, responsible use while supporting long-term performance.
- 650% elongation supports flexibility through temperature swings and substrate movement.
- 88% light reflectivity helps keep the surface cooler under sun exposure.
- Adheres to metal roofing, tar, rolled roofs, and more for broad compatibility.
- Brush, roll, or spray application enables efficient coverage on various roof types.
- Non-toxic, eco-friendly, low-VOC; made in the USA.
- packaged in a convenient 1-gallon container for common low-slope projects.

Application and care
Apply using your preferred method—brush, roller, or spray—for a smooth, even layer. The elastomeric film forms a flexible shield that resists cracking as the roof expands and contracts. Drying and curing depend on ambient temperature and humidity, so follow label guidance for best results and plan accordingly to minimize downtime.

FAQ
Q: What surfaces can AMES Maximum-Stretch Coat be used on?
A: It adheres to metal, tar, rolled roofing, and other common low-slope surfaces, offering flexible sealing for maintenance and waterproofing.
Q: Is AMES Maximum-Stretch eco-friendly or low-VOC?
A: Yes, it is non-toxic, eco-friendly, low-VOC, and made in the USA.
